2025 Fantasy Outlook
After spending parts of six seasons in the minors, Schneemann made his MLB debut in 2024. The 27-year-old rookie got off to a strong start, posting an .836 OPS across 21 games in June after first getting the call. However, Schneemann proceeded to post a .600 OPS with a .199 batting average over his final 52 games. During that final stretch, he also struck out 33.6 percent of the time. Oddly, the lefty bat performed much better against southpaws, registering a .993 OPS in those matchups, though he only saw 36 plate appearances against lefties all year. Looking ahead, Schneemann projects as a platoon option who should continue to see more run against righties. He has the versatility to play multiple positions, which boosts his overall usefulness, though Schneemann will need to see a bump in playing time to take a step forward for fantasy purposes. Paves way for win with home run
Schneemann went 2-for-4 with a three-run home run Wednesday in a 4-2 win against San Francisco.
ANALYSIS
Schneemann had the biggest hit of the night for either team with his three-run blast off Justin Verlander in the fourth inning. The long ball was his first extra-base hit since he rapped two doubles against the Yankees on June 4. Schneemann remains in a strong-side platoon role -- he regularly rests against lefty starters -- which dings his fantasy value despite a relatively promising campaign that includes a .775 OPS, eight homers, 21 RBI, 22 runs and five stolen bases through 56 games.
